IGCSE is an international board of education and in India there are various Schools offering this model.

There are various uses of IGCSE board and some of them are as follows -

1.) IGCSE as mentioned is a international board and hence it provides the best form of education.

2.) Subjects involved in their curriculum are dynamic and can help in gaining a good amount of Knowledge

3.) It helps in creating a overall personality of student and can help him/her in many exams.

4.) It is really necessary to expand our education as now a day everyone dreams of studying aboard and hence best education from a young age can be helpful.

5.) All the reputed universities really acknowledge the education from IGCSE board.
